'Curry powder' definitions:

Definition of 'curry powder'

(from WordNet)
noun
Pungent blend of cumin and ground coriander seed and turmeric and other spices

Definition of 'Curry powder'

From: GCIDE
  • Curry \Cur"ry\, n. [Tamil kari.] [Written also currie.] [1913 Webster]
  • 1. (Cookery) A kind of sauce much used in India, containing garlic, pepper, ginger, and other strong spices. [1913 Webster]
  • 2. A stew of fowl, fish, or game, cooked with curry. [1913 Webster]
  • Curry powder (Cookery), a condiment used for making curry, formed of various materials, including strong spices, as pepper, ginger, garlic, coriander seed, etc. [1913 Webster]
